Transaction 08511785f274a0fb1efebe820d2ae791f65c3050e8f9e9bf79ef659291a0476c

39 Input
1 Outputs
  • 08511785f274a0fb1efebe820d2ae791f65c3050e8f9e9bf79ef659291a0476c:0
  • value  15000000
    address  3QTUxAKmHqLAkvAjSvPxYoi5yUVRPQm2Cx